Bacon was at the highest prices 011 record in the United Kingdom last month, and there is 110 prospect of a cheapening, until the nutnnm. Among the reasons' given for the jennies* nre—(l) the rav«p['3 of swine fever, (2) the stoppage of supplies from Canada and the United States, (3) the dearne?s of all kinds of forHse, and (4) the enormous increase in the demand for bacon.
